android 动态改变控件位置和大小 .

时间:2015-03-05 19:09:27   收藏:0   阅读:891
动态改变控件位置的方法:
setPadding()的方法更改布局位置。
如我要把Imageview下移200px:     
       ImageView.setPadding( ImageView.getPaddingLeft(),  ImageView.getPaddingTop()+200,  
ImageView.getPaddingRight(),  ImageView.getPaddingBottom());
 
 
动态改变控件大小的方法:
 
1、声明控件参数获取对象 LayoutParams lp;
2、获取控件参数: lp = 控件id.getLayoutParams();
3、设置控件参数:如高度。   lp.height -= 10;
4:、使设置生效:控件id.setLayoutParams(lp);

原文:http://www.cnblogs.com/wangluochong/p/4316323.html

评论(0
© 2014 bubuko.com 版权所有 - 联系我们:wmxa8@hotmail.com
打开技术之扣,分享程序人生!